Penguin sees eBook growth increase by 106% in 2011
Penguin has divulged their 2011 sales today and the company has experienced tremendous growth in the digital department. eBook sales accounted for over 12% of the companies yearly sales and made them around 152 million dollars. Although sales for digital content seems to be increasing every year it is still a drop in bucket for their print business. LA Times to Adopt Paywall March 5th
The Los Angles Times online version is going the route of the paywall structure for digital content starting March 5th 2012. Users will be able to view up to 15 free stories per month and then be mandated to pay to continue reading.The LA Times is going to be offering an introductory rate of 0.99 for the first month of its digital subscription plan.
